The origins of "Ordinary World" were the results of tragedy: the death of singer Simon Le Bon's good friend, David Miles, of a drug overdose in 1986. “I'm not a big believer in the supernatural, but six years after [my friend's death], I started to feel a weight inside me," Le Bon told Paste in 2017.
